Ordinals
beta
Sat 1242323339961745
decimal
286929.839961745
degree
0°76929′657″839961745‴
percentile
59.158254348966736%
name
faybyiuztsa
cycle
0
epoch
1
period
142
block
286929
offset
839961745
timestamp
2014-02-20 19:51:50 UTC
rarity
common
prev
next